- The periodic table has several blocks of elements, each named after the characteristic orbital of their valence electrons or vacancies1234:
- s-block: Elements in this block have their valence electrons in s orbitals.
- p-block: Elements in this block have their valence electrons in p orbitals.
- d-block: Elements in this block have their valence electrons in d orbitals.
- f-block: Elements in this block have their valence electrons in f orbitals.

Block Elements is a Unicode block containing square block symbols of various fill and shading. Used along with block elements are box-drawing characters, shade characters, and terminal graphic characters. These can be used for filling regions of the screen and portraying drop shadows.
